KUALA LUMPUR, Sept 19 (Bernama) -- The government must identify its priorities in Budget 2013, Former Deputy Prime Minister Tun Musa Hitam said today.
"Politics is heating up and and a national budget is about to be presented. Everybody is expecting the most out of it.
"Hopefully, the government is able to recognise whether the budget is for short-term or long-term," he told reporters when asked on his expectations from Budget 2013.
Prime Minister Datuk Seri Najib Tun Razak, who is also Finance Minister, will table Budget 2013 in Parliament on Sept 28.
Musa, the Jury Chairman for the Royal Award for Islamic Finance, was met after announcing the Royal Award recipients today.
The Royal Award, an international award, was spearheaded by the Malaysia International Islamic Financial Centre Initiative and was supported by Bank Negara Malaysia and Securities Commission Malaysia.
